True, bright white coloration is uncommon in the arachnid world. Many spiders that appear pale are actually translucent, cream, or faint yellow. The few species that exhibit a truly white color do so for specialized reasons, usually connected to ambush predation. Understanding the biology behind the color is the first step in identifying these creatures.
The Most Common White Spiders
The most commonly encountered truly white spiders belong to the Thomisidae family, known as flower or crab spiders. The female Goldenrod Crab Spider (Misumena vatia) is the most recognizable example, displaying a bright white body with a bulbous abdomen and two pairs of noticeably longer front legs. These ambush predators do not spin a web, instead lying in wait on white flowers like daisies or Queen Anne’s lace.
Their crab-like shape and ability to walk sideways allow them to maneuver effectively on blossoms, waiting motionless for pollinators. Females are significantly larger than males and are capable of the dramatic color change that aids their camouflage. Their venom subdues large insects like bees and butterflies but is harmless to humans.
Yellow Sac Spiders (Cheiracanthium) are frequently mistaken for white spiders. While typically pale beige, cream, or light yellow, some individuals, especially juveniles, appear white. These active, nocturnal hunters do not build webs. Instead, they create small, flat silken sacs in sheltered spots, such as ceiling corners or under leaves, where they rest during the day.
Ghost Spiders (family Anyphaenidae) are characterized by their pale, translucent, or yellowish-white bodies. These spiders are active, fast-moving hunters, often seen scurrying across walls or foliage at night. They are not web-builders, but they construct silk retreats in crevices or under bark for resting and egg-laying. Ghost spiders are generally small, typically ranging from 5 to 10 millimeters in body length.
Why Spiders Use White Coloration
The white appearance is a highly refined adaptation used primarily for crypsis, or camouflage, especially by ambush hunters. For flower-dwelling crab spiders, the bright white color allows them to blend perfectly into light-colored flower petals, rendering them invisible to approaching insect prey. This offensive tactic dramatically increases their hunting success.
The mechanism for white coloration often involves specialized cells within the spider’s body. The white color is frequently structural, caused by the storage of guanine crystals in cells beneath the cuticle. Guanine, a waste product, is crystallized in these specialized cells, which scatter incident light to produce a bright, matte white or silvery appearance.
In species like the Goldenrod Crab Spider, this guanine layer provides a white background against which other pigments can be deployed or removed. The spider can actively change its color from white to yellow over several days or weeks by synthesizing or breaking down a yellow ommochrome pigment. This morphological color change enables the spider to match the color of its current flower habitat.
Safety and Identification of Pale Spiders
The majority of common white spiders, such as Flower Crab Spiders and Ghost Spiders, are not considered a threat to humans. Their fangs are generally too small or their venom too mild to cause more than localized, temporary irritation if a bite occurs. However, relying on color alone for safety assessment is unreliable, as many medically significant spiders have pale stages or variations.
The Yellow Sac Spider is the most notable exception among pale spiders and is often cited as the cause of most indoor human-spider interactions. Their bite is medically significant, capable of causing localized pain, swelling, and sometimes a necrotic lesion that is less severe than a Brown Recluse bite. Identification should focus on their distinctive long front legs and their habit of building a silken sac in wall-ceiling corners.
To properly identify a pale spider beyond its color, observe specific anatomical details and behavior cues. Look for the spider’s eye arrangement, a definitive identifier for most families, or the presence or absence of a web. Crab spiders have a wide, crab-like body and hold their long front legs out to the side. Ghost Spiders are slender, very fast runners with long spinnerets at the tip of the abdomen.
